> Thomas Petazzoni wrote:
> 
> > For example, Berlin is a Länder, so it has an administrative
> > boundary of level 4. But Berlin is also a city, so why doesn't it
> > have an administrative boundary of 8 ?
> 
> Indeed, and that's the way we do it in The Netherlands, for the few 
> cases where, in our case, admin_level 8==10. I don't see why Berlin 
> couldn't have both a relation as Land and as city, covering exactly
> the same outline.

Ok, so France and Nederlands are doing this, so why not Germany ? :-)

> And speaking of our Dutch admin_level=10: it would be good to be able
> to use that level in Maposmatic as well. I can elaborate as to what
> it stands for in NL and why it's logical to print city maps from that 
> level, but I'll leave that for another time.

True. In France, cities like Paris, Lyon and Marseille (level 8) are
divided into arrondissements (level 10). This administrative level
makes sense, so we could enable it.
